My point is that I don't think the last offer to Kirk by the Skins was a good one because it had no chance of being accepted based on the knowledge the Skins acquired in past negotiations with Kirk's agent.

If they want to franchise him, they should just do it. If they don't want him, they should just let him sign elsewhere. The only purpose I can see to making him an offer that they know he won't accept is to mollify the ticket holders, as in "We tried".

p.s. My thoughts on this are based on my low regard for how the FO has handled this up to now. I don't foresee the FO suddenly making a competitive offer for his services. If they're not able to read the marketplace, or they are in their own fantasy world about what it will take to sign him, or they just want to look good to the ticket holders, or they just don't give a damn whether he signs or not, then they are just wasting their time preparing an offer.

Don't agree. They should make the highest offer they feel comfortable making. If he's not interested, then he leaves. That's business.

Franchise tag should be off the table. $34M for one season, only to be back in this same predicament next year, makes no sense.

He's shown that he'll just sign it immediately and then shut down negotiations until he's through playing under it. Once you tag him, he won't negotiate with you.
